Based on the results of recently concluded stress tests, U.S. regulators told Citigroup Inc and Bank of America Corp they may need to raise more capital, the Wall Street Journal said, citing people familiar with the situation.

The shortfall in capital amounts to billions of dollars at BofA, the paper said, citing people familiar with the bank.

Both banks plan to respond with detailed rebuttals, the people told the paper, adding BofA's appeal is expected by Tuesday.
